Our Fiberglass Endless Pool employs the most durable
material available. The molded single shell provides an
attractive, smooth finish that fits into many design
schemes. The clean interior with built-in stairs and rear
bench provides a traditional pool look. In commercial
settings the tough finish and greater depth easily
accommodate heavy use, underwater treadmills and
higher water temperatures.
Your first decision is how you wish the pool to appear in your
space: fully in-ground, partially in-ground or fully aboveground.
Fully in-ground and partially in-ground appearances can be
achieved either by digging a hole, installing the pool and then
backfilling around the pool or by using our optional external
bracing system and then decking up around the pool. This latter
approach is often employed indoors where a larger room is being
constructed and a crawl space is desired.
Fully In-Ground Pool with Backfill:
This is the traditional method of installing a fiberglass pool and involves first digging a hole 10' wide by 20' long and approximately
5' deep for our standard model. The exact depth will depend on your planned interface between the pool and the surrounding deck.
The pool is then lowered into a prepared hole and sand is used as backfill to support the pool and withstand the
hydrostatic load of a water filled pool. Finally, concrete is poured around the perimeter of the pool.
 |
Partially In-Ground Pool with Backfill:
The backfilled Fiberglass Endless Pool can extend up out of the ground as much as 18" without lateral support if the bottom 42" or
more is fully supported with backfill. At the front, where the equipment is mounted, up to 24" must be exposed as shown. With
partially in-ground pools the hole can be narrower requiring less excavation. If the pool protrudes more than 12" out of the ground
the hole can be as little as 9' wide. When the partially in-ground method is employed a kneewall is typically constructed to provide
a suitable seat or coping around the pool.
Aboveground with optional bracing system:
Fully aboveground effect
With our standard depth Fiberglass Endless Pool you may purchase a supplementary external bracing system that is installed at the
factory and allows the pool to be freestanding. When this system is used the pool may be installed aboveground. This external bracing
system is not available with our 5' 6" and our 6' 0" tall models.
Partially in-ground effect
With this option the pool rests on a solid level surface fully aboveground and a deck is brought up to whatever height is desired
to achieve the built in look. The optional external bracing system is required as described above and if possible the pool should be
braced back to the surrounding deck to increase stiffness. A kneewall is typically constructed to provide a suitable seat or coping
around the pool.
Fully in-ground effect
With this option the pool rests on a solid level surface fully aboveground and a deck is brought up flush with the top of the pool to
achieve a built in look. Again, the optional external bracing system is required which is only available with our 5' 0" tall pool (4' 6"
water depth). If possible the pool should be braced back to the surrounding deck to increase stiffness.
